About the Job
The Grain Sales Associate position is responsible for developing long-term relationships with identified customers, working both over the phone and face-to-face with grain producers on the farm. The ideal candidate will have a strong understanding of the agricultural industry and be able to work independently and as part of a team.
Responsibilities
• Develop long-term relationships with identified customers
• Work both over the phone and face-to-face with grain producers on the farm
• Gain hands-on experience by working on various projects in the agricultural sales and marketing area
• Help farmers prosper and improve their return by utilizing Cargill’s full range of products
• Solve customer problems and create new opportunities
Qualifications
• Currently pursuing a Diploma or Bachelor’s degree from an accredited program graduating between December 2023 and August 2024
• Possess a valid Canadian drivers licence in good standing authorizing you to drive independently during your employment
• Must be legally entitled to work for Cargill in Canada
• Demonstrated ability to work effectively with individuals from a diverse set of backgrounds
• Ability to contribute, both as part of a team and individually
